Principal job summary

Due to the retirement of our current Principal, the Governors of Goldwyn School are seeking to appoint an exceptional, motivated and inspirational Principal who is passionate about the education of students who have Special Educational Needs. We are an Outstanding and unique secondary (11-18) SEMH special school in Kent, operating over 4 sites in Ashford and Folkestone, with each site running its own distinctive educational pathway. We are a highly regarded and successful school which has expanded its provision to meet the needs of our increasingly complex and vulnerable students. We work closely with parents, carers and other agencies to give every student high quality education and care. Goldwyn has experienced and specialist staff who are dedicated to meeting the educational needs of all students. It is desirable for applicants to have leadership expertise in the education of students who have Special Educational Needs and are committed to providing the best quality education and having high aspirations for their futures. Goldwyn School is committed to the highest standards in safeguarding procedures and promoting the welfare of every student and we expect all our staff to share this commitment. References may be taken up before interview and the successful applicant will undertake an enhanced DBS check.

Goldwyn is a pioneering school that provides an exciting, high achieving and creative curriculum for students who have a learning difference. Every child at Goldwyn is unique and it is our mission to design a learning pathway that reflects high GCSE aspirations as well as encouraging their inherent talents through music, art, languages, technology, science, sport, vocational education and much more. The Goldwyn leaders and all our staff are inspirational and committed to providing a happy, secure and stimulating school in which students enjoy their learning. We provide an education which develops the whole child academically, socially and emotionally. We focus our energies on ensuring that all children aim for excellence in their work and are able to achieve the very best that they can.

Goldwyn School is a KCC Foundation Special School for children and young people with an EHCP for SEMH needs from age 11 to 18. Students who are admitted to the school have complex and wide ranging difficulties and come from a wide range of socio-economic backgrounds and a wide geographical area.

Goldwyn School is an Outstanding School for students with SEMH needs, and consists of:
• Goldwyn Ashford in Great Chart, Ashford (TN23 3BT)
• Goldwyn Folkestone in Parkfield Road, Folkestone (CT19 5BY)
• Goldwyn Sixth Form in Leacon Road, Ashford, Kent (TN23 4FB)
• Goldwyn Plus in Beaver Lane, Ashford (TN23 5NX) (our alternative curriculum programme)
